Black Mirror

Black Mirror is a speculative fiction anthology series exploring the dark, often dystopian, side of technology and its impact on modern society, presenting standalone stories with new characters and plots that function as cautionary tales about our near future, from social media's effects and AI to surveillance and the perversion of human nature through tech. Each episode acts as a "black mirror," reflecting humanity's worst instincts and the unintended consequences of innovation, often with a satirical twist and unexpected endings.
